After many weeks of practice I manage to do this quite difficult sleight but almost always it flashes under the card. What am I doing wrong ? Al Schneider doesn't says anything about position of cards and flashing. Any tips?

One way that people flash is to bend the card too much before the snap. You really don't need to bend it more than a bit to get a magical snap. That may be the problem, unless you are inadvertently lifting the coin above the card, which can be easily remidied by just paying attention.

It would seems that you need to point the edge of the card facing your specator downward, to hide your fingers. You also need to take into account the position of your body and hand, as well as the camera. You might want to stand up to make the tilting of the card edge downward a bit easier. For me, this should correct the issue.
Also, is the camera at the eye level of your spectators, or below? If below, you could be getting an angle that your audience wouldn't see
